We're migrating over to a Meraki stack (2 x MX105's, 2 x C9300-M's, 4 x MS225's, APs, etc) from a Nexus (9372) and Catalyst (2960) set up. Trying to do this in a manner so slowly migrate instead of hoping my Meraki configuration is correct and doing a full cut over. In the meantime, we're having a lot of issues with STP. We have one trunk between a Nexus and a 9300. STP doesnt seem to be behaving properly, ie the Nexus thinks its the root bridge, and so does the Meraki side.. sometimes even the MS225's think they're the root bridge. In our searches, we stumbled across some items that say Cisco/Meraki STP don't play nicely together, at least in their default configurations. Best I can tell, the Nexus/Catalyst side are using Rapid PVST mode, and the Meraki has RSTP enabled. The documentation is a little Greek, so trying to get a little guidance on the best way to (temporarily) set this up so I'm not battling outages from STP. Right now, In "Switch Settings" I have my C9300 stack with a priority of 40960, and my MS225's at 53248. I believe the Nexus side of things are around The Nexus VLANs are in the 24000 range for priorities. Since we're moving to the Meraki's.. ideally I'd want that side to be the root, but before lowering their priorities, I want to make sure the Nexus/catalyst side of things "talk" happily.
